Adjuvant pembrolizumab (Keytruda) continued to provide a disease-free survival (DFS) benefit in patients with renal-cell carcinoma (RCC) at intermediate-high or high risk of recurrence after nephrectomy, according to 30-month follow-up data from the KEYNOTE-564 trial presented at the 2022 ASCO Genitourinary Cancers Symposium.

Treatment with nivolumab (Opdivo) plus ipilimumab (Yervoy) in the neoadjuvant setting plus adjuvant nivolumab resulted in a high rate of pathologic complete response (pCR) in patients with resectable microsatellite instability (MSI)/mismatch repair deficient (dMMR) oeso-gastric junction (OGJ) adenocarcinoma, according to findings from the GERCOR NEONIPIGA clinical trial, which were presented by Thierry André, MD, Professor, Medical Oncology, Sorbonne Université, Hôpital Saint Antoine, Paris, France, at the 2022 ASCO Gastrointestinal Cancers Symposium.
